Rodolfo E. SALAZAR

Born in Guatemala City, Guatemala, 1970; admitted to bar, 2000, Guatemala. Graduate of Francisco Marroquin University School of Law, Attorney at Law and Notary Public, Guatemala. Georgetown University Law Center and the INCAE Business School, Executive Program "Legal Issues of International Business"; San Carlos University of Guatemala School of Law, Diploma on Indigenous Law and the aplication of the 169 Treaty of the International Labour Organization (2005). Former Administrative Law Professor, Del Istmo University, Guatemala and Former Administrative Law Professor, Rafael Landívar University, Guatemala. Legal advisor of Govermental entities and private companies related to Ports, Mines, Electricity, Free Zones and Competition. MEMBER: Guatemala Bar Association; Center for the Defense of the Constitution (CEDECON). Recognized in the following international independent publications: Latin Lawyer 250 and  International Financial Law Review 1000. PRACTICE AREAS: Telecommunications Law; Energy Law; Constitutional Law; Administrative Law; Corporate and Commercial Law; Trusts; Civil Law; Financial Law; Insurance Law, Mining law.
